Abstract :
Weir buildings that have been built for a long time require operation and maintenance so that their existence can always operate and function properly and sustainably. To assess the performance of the jelis weir, a discharge measurement simulation is carried out using a current meter measuring device and an assessment of the condition of the building. For the measurement of discharge in the measuring building using the SNI8066;2015 calibration tuning and analysis of the condition of the weir building using the IKS1 (Irrigation System Performance Index) method based on the Minister of PUPR Regulation Number 12/PRT/M/2015 concerning Exploitation and Irrigation Maintenance The results of the discharge measurement are compared with the standard discharge at the location 1 at 10 cm opening Q=89.64 l/sec (difference -10.52%), opening 20 cm Q=145.62 l/sec(difference 2.41%>), opening 30 cm Q=4J3, 64 l/s (difference l.86%), on site 2 at the door opening 10 cm Q=92.67 l/sec (difference -14.25%), opening 20 cm Q= 141.89 l/sec(difference 4.78%>), opening 30 cm 0=414, 84 l/sec (difference 1.57%) at the two measurement locations, the difference between the standard discharge coefficient reading the discharge label and the measurement calibration coefficient was f 2.35%, while the error response to reading the discharge label on the Threshold Width/Drempel measuring instrument was less than <2%. The accuracy of the readings of the water discharge in the measuring building is not as it should be so that it affects irrigation water services, this is caused by various hats, including the value of roughness, sediment, age and the viscosity of the water itself. The results of the dam performance assessment are based on the condition of the building where 6 aspects can be assessed for the condition of the building, namely the main building, intake building, drain building, mud bag, sluice gate, the percentage of sediment obtained by the Jetis weir index value in GOOD condition and component damage to the Jetis weir of f7.05% Keywords : Coefficient of Debit, Building Measure, Performance of Weir Building, Current Meter
